Easy to peel is number one when you are boiling eggs. When I was in catering, we boiled about 5000 eggs a year, maybe more. This was our method, and one I use at home today. I have scaled it down for your home kitchen. Ingredients:
6 eggs |
2 -3 cups cold water |
2 cups ice |
Directions:
1. Place eggs in pot, cover with enough water to rise 2 above the eggs. 2. Place over high heat and bring to a boil, uncovered. 3. Turn to med high heat, hot enough that the water is still boiling. 4. Set the timer for 8 min's. 5. Drain, rinse with cold water, drain again. 6. With the eggs still in the pot, cover with cold water,then add the ice. 7. Let stand for 5 min's before peeling. |
